Transaction 15a98deaf1b70ef22542d0058e0f84d7c938aa4075e094f826ba03057aa77a17

1 Input
2 Outputs
  • 15a98deaf1b70ef22542d0058e0f84d7c938aa4075e094f826ba03057aa77a17:0
  • value  98300000
    address  1DuAYVFarWJhF4NYStjee8kcCqiWUCvEQb
  • 15a98deaf1b70ef22542d0058e0f84d7c938aa4075e094f826ba03057aa77a17:1
  • value  675500563
    address  15mMFkCUydtaXhUeMfLJeW54oKFN7upSyz